原创 Git使用完全解析(含實操常用命令)

文章目錄git結構git和SVN有什麼區別(集中式控制和分佈式控制的區別)添加公鑰查看git配置克隆項目分支對比分支git fetch和pull的區別撤銷撤銷某次commit(未push到遠程)撤銷某次push本地所有文件直接覆蓋

原创 什麼是Nginx?有什麼用?

參考資料 https://blog.csdn.net/qq_15037231/article/details/80406679 https://www.cnblogs.com/mq0036/p/9794540.html https

原创 Mysql 數據庫—— 概念介紹

文章目錄概念兩種數據庫什麼是DBMSSQL的分類概念名字 概念 數據庫本質是文件存儲在硬盤中。 我們需要通過SQL語句來操作文件中的數據。 SQL語句是通用操作數據庫語言。可以操作多種數據庫。 數據庫客戶端可視化軟件比如Mysql

原创 Mysql數據庫——幾個join的區別

文章目錄幾個join的區別inner join (join)left joinright joinfull join 創數據庫多表查詢之 where & INNER JOIN 幾個join的區別 通過一個例子來說明幾個join:

原创 消息隊列MQ與微消息隊列MQTT

文章目錄參考文章什麼是消息隊列,什麼是RPC爲什麼要使用MQ消息隊列1. 解耦(可用性)2. 流量削峯3. 數據分發消息隊列的缺點多種主流傳統消息隊列MQ對比傳統消息隊列RocketMQ和微消息隊列MQTT對比 參考文章 http

原创 C++學習筆記 —— 函數默認值、static、友元

文章目錄函數默認值static靜態成員變量靜態成員函數引出友元 函數默認值 void func(int a, int b = 10, int c =1) { cout<< a + b + c << endl; } 若一個函數

原创 C++學習筆記 —— STL之stack 和queue

文章目錄隊列和棧 隊列和棧 #include <iostream> #include <stack> #include <queue> using namespace std; int main() { // stac

原创 java多線程 —— 面試題集合(最全集合)

文章目錄說明一、基本概念多線程有什麼用?線程、進程、協程的區別什麼是多線程上下文切換?如何減少上下文切換,提高操作系統效率什麼是線程安全一個線程終止,程序會終止嗎一個線程如果出現了運行時異常會怎麼樣你對線程優先級的理解是什麼?二、

原创 加密,簽名,token解釋及場景分析

文章目錄加密使用場景對稱加密和非對稱加密簽名使用場景含義Tokencookie和session 參考文章:數據的加密與簽名 徹底理解cookie,session,token 加密 使用場景 當我們傳輸數據時,如果數據被截獲了,那麼

原创 C++學習筆記 —— 運算符重載

文章目錄運算符重載有兩種方式+號運算符重載問題成員函數重載,接收一個參數友元函數重載:兩個參數 運算符重載實質上是一個函數的重載。他提供了c++的可擴展行,也是c++最吸引人的地方之一。 比如我們定一個了兩個string對象a 和

原创 C++學習筆記 —— 單例模式

文章目錄什麼是單例具體使用場景單例模式案例主席模式打印機模式最推薦的懶漢式單例代碼 參考 C++ 單例模式總結與剖析 什麼是單例 目的:創建類中的對象,並且保證只有一個對象實例。 單例類內部實現只生成一個唯一實例,同時他提供一個靜

原创 什麼是Spring依賴注入

參考文檔 https://segmentfault.com/a/1190000018972356 什麼是Spring的依賴注入?有什麼好處 依賴注入:是指程序運行過程中,如果需要創建一個對象,無須再代碼中new創建,而是依賴外部的

原创 C++學習筆記 —— 命名空間、內聯函數、按值/引用/指針傳遞

文章目錄命名空間問題出現使用命名空間的三種方式內聯函數什麼是內聯函數慎用內聯內聯函數使用引用按值傳遞,引用傳遞,指針傳遞區別 命名空間 問題出現 比如兩個頭文件中PeopleA.h和PeopleB.h 我們定義類兩個相同的Stud

原创 數據結構與算法 —— 常用時間複雜度與空間複雜度

文章目錄常用數據結構和算法時間複雜度速查表時間複雜度常見的算法時間複雜度由小到大依次爲:Ο(1)Ο(logn)O(N)O(nlogN)O(n^2) O(n³)如何計算時間複雜度舉例:計算1+2+3….n舉例:斐波那契數列。1,1

原创 數據結構與算法 —— 快速冪算法

文章目錄1. 引出快速冪算法2. 簡化語句3. 使用位運算來提升性能4. 對應leetcode題型 參考的是大神的文章,這篇文章相當好 https://blog.csdn.net/qq_19782019/article/detai